Nuclear energy, once deemed unsuitable for Singapore. The identified as a potential power source for the country by 2050 in a new report published on Tuesday (March 22).


The report, commissioned by the Energy Market Authority (EMA), concluded that nuclear energy could by 2050 supply about 10 per cent of the country's needs, with advancements in nuclear technology making it safer and more reliable.

Rolleyes The potential use of nuclear energy in Singapore's power mix had been identified in one of three scenarios in the Energy 2050 Committee report.

EMA noted, there are ongoing efforts to decarbonise the power sector, such as its earlier announced target to import up to four gigawatts of low-carbon electricity by 2035. Also taking active steps to invest in the research of low-carbon technologies, such as hydrogen and geothermal energy, and...continues.

Monitor global developments in areas such as nuclear energy and their implications for Singapore.
